Whisk Breakfast & Brunch is a highly-rated, Black-owned restaurant in East Point, Atlanta, offering a delightful dining experience with a focus on breakfast and brunch. Known for its 4.9-star rating, the restaurant features a clean, comfy ambiance with charming decor, exceptional hospitality, and delicious, creatively prepared dishes like French toast bites and loaded breakfast potatoes. It caters to locals and visitors seeking a top-tier meal with attentive service, valet parking options, and a convenient QR code payment system.
